Gilbane Development Company Names James Patchett as CEO

Gilbane Development Company, the real estate development and asset management arm of Gilbane, Inc. today announced the appointment of James Patchett as its new president and chief executive officer. He will succeed Edward Broderick who was recently appointed chief executive officer of Gilbane and served as president of Gilbane Development since January 2014.

With over $8.5 billion in total development, Gilbane Development has experienced exponential growth over the past decade and is a Top 10 Student Housing Developer (Student Housing Business). Under Patchett’s leadership, Gilbane Development is set for a continued growth trajectory, especially in the core market areas of student housing, affordable and mixed-income housing, market-rate housing, and public-private partnerships.

Recent notable successes for Gilbane Development include:

  • Launching a $500+ million strategic partnership with CBRE Investment Management (CBREIM) for purpose-built student housing properties across the country;
  • Working with the public sector to build or rehabilitate over 8,000 affordable/mixed-income units totaling nearly $3 billion.
  • Delivering nearly $400 million in development of two new transit-oriented projects totaling 1,000+ units at Metro stations in Maryland;
  • Delivering $2.4 billion in comprehensive public-private solutions for institutional and government clients, encompassing design, build, finance, operate, and maintain models;
  • Building a property management platform with the formation of three new affiliated businesses managing nearly 3,000 units with over 10,000 beds – Inwood Management, Eastaway Property Management and Calvary Street Management.

Patchett’s leadership and prior experience have supported transformation, growth, and innovation. Prior to joining Gilbane Development, he served as Partner in the Real Estate practice at McKinsey & Company and as President & CEO of the New York City Economic Development Corporation where he ran a portfolio of over 60 million square feet of real estate, managed $10 billion in development and infrastructure projects, and helped establish New York City as an innovation hub in life sciences, fintech, cybersecurity, and green energy.

He also previously served as Chief Executive Officer at A&E Real Estate, a vertically integrated real estate management and investment firm. James also was Vice President in the Urban Investment Group of Goldman Sachs, investing equity and debt in real estate projects across the U.S. In addition, he served as Chief of Staff to the NYC Deputy Mayor for Housing and Economic Development. James holds a BA in Economics from Amherst College and an MBA from Stanford Graduate School of Business.

About Gilbane Development Company

Gilbane Development is the real estate development, investment, ownership, and property management arm of Gilbane, Inc., a family-owned company founded in 1870. With over $8.5 billion in development and more than 25,000 units of housing completed or underway, including over 10,000 units of affordable housing, Gilbane Development is a trusted partner to public and private partners and institutions and government clients across the United States.  Leveraging our deep expertise in finance, project management, asset management and operations, we develop award-winning projects and support dynamic communities across all asset classes.
